Abstract

A corona igniter 20 includes a central electrode 34 for receiving a high radio frequency voltage from a power source and emitting a radio frequency electric field to ionize a fuel-air mixture and provide a corona discharge 22 . The corona igniter 20 includes an insulator 38 extending along the central electrode 34 longitudinally past the central electrode 34 to an insulator firing end 40 . The insulator firing surface 42 and the center axis A present an angle α of not greater than 90 degrees therebetween, for example the insulator firing surface may be concave. The central electrode 34 may also include a firing tip 50 , in which case the insulator firing surface 42 surrounds all sides of the firing tip 50 . The geometry of the insulator firing surface 42 concentrates and directs the corona discharge 22.

Claims (59)

1. A corona igniter, comprising:

a central electrode extending longitudinally along a center axis to an electrode firing end for receiving a radio frequency voltage and emitting a radio frequency electric field from said electrode firing end to ionize a fuel-air mixture and provide a corona discharge,

an insulator extending along said central electrode longitudinally past said electrode firing end to an insulator firing end,

said insulator including an insulator firing surface adjacent said insulator firing end, and

said insulator firing surface and said center axis presenting an angle of not greater than 90 degrees therebetween.

2. The corona igniter of claim 1 wherein said insulator extends longitudinally past said electrode firing end.

3. The corona igniter of claim 1 wherein said insulator firing surface surrounds said electrode firing end.

4. The corona igniter of claim 1 wherein said insulator presents a bore for receiving said central electrode and said insulator firing surface extends transversely from said bore to said insulator firing end.

5. The corona igniter of claim 1 wherein said insulator firing surface is concave.

6. The corona igniter of claim 1 wherein said insulator firing surface is planar.

7. The corona igniter of claim 1 wherein said insulator firing surface and said center axis present an angle of 30 to 60 degrees therebetween.

8. The corona igniter of claim 1 wherein said insulator firing surface and said center axis present an angle of 10 to 30 degrees therebetween.

9. The corona igniter of claim 1 wherein said central electrode includes a firing tip adjacent said electrode firing end for emitting the radio frequency electrical field and said insulator firing surface extends radially outwardly of said firing tip.

10. The corona igniter of claim 9 wherein said firing tip includes a plurality of prongs each extending radially outwardly from said center axis.

11. The corona igniter of claim 1 wherein said insulator firing surface and said center axis present an angle of less than 90 degrees therebetween.

12. The corona igniter of claim 9 wherein said insulator firing surface surrounds said firing tip.
